Turn even the most stressful situation into an opportunity to shine for you and your team. People aren't born to be high-performing leaders; instead, they need to learn to develop the time-proven characteristics of great leadership. "Leadership Under Pressure" shows you how to acquire these characteristics, motivate your people, and achieve remarkable results across your organization-particularly during times of change and stress. This quick-hitting, hands-on rulebook is chock-full of hard-won advice and action steps for keeping your cool under pressure and inspiring incredible performance from your team.You'll see how to: start turning problems into opportunities that can enhance your career; practice "humanagement" - using the job to develop the person while having fun in the process; overcome your team's roadblocks to goal achievement; develop an organization with free-flowing, two-way communication, from top-to-bottom; know the signs of low morale, take immediate action to counteract the causes, and make strategic plans to keep spirits from falling again; and, encourage inspired thinking by relaxing old rules of conformity and publicly recognizing new ideas. "Leadership Under Pressure" prepares you to meet all leadership challenges, whether anticipated or unexpected.
